How do employees' payment legislations protect staff members? These regulations give a safeguard for employees who suffer occupational injuries or ailments, guaranteeing they get needed clinical treatment and financial support. By developing a no-fault system, employees' payment removes the demand for staff members to confirm employer negligence to get benefits. This enables hurt employees to accessibility coverage for clinical expenses, recovery, and wage loss without dealing with extensive lawful fights. Additionally, these laws often consist of arrangements for occupation rehab, assisting employees return to work in a suitable capacity.Employers gain from workers' payment legislations also, as they restrict obligation and secure versus claims associated with office injuries. Each state provides its very own guidelines, causing variants in benefits and protection. Understanding these laws is vital for employees seeking to browse the intricacies of cases and assure their rights are supported while recovering from work-related events.

Common Obstacles in Claims Processing
Steering through the usually convoluted landscape of workers' compensation insurance claims can provide various challenges that may hinder a staff member's capacity to safeguard advantages. One major barrier is the complexity of the paperwork involved, which typically consists of clinical records, occurrence records, and thorough case kinds. Missing out on or insufficient documents can lead to delays or denials. Furthermore, varying state legislations add another layer of difficulty, as timelines and requirements differ significantly. Workers might likewise deal with pushback from insurance coverage firms, which frequently aim to minimize payouts and may challenge the authenticity of an insurance claim. Additionally, the emotional toll of an injury can impair a worker's emphasis, making complex the claims procedure. Limited due dates and the stress to return to function can create extra anxiety, typically resulting in rushed or improperly prepared claims. These difficulties highlight the importance of comprehending the procedure thoroughly to enhance the opportunities of a successful result.The Duty of a Lawyer in Your Insurance claim
